G-Dragon has officially launched legal proceedings against those spreading malicious rumors and defamatory posts online.
On October 17, Galaxy Corporation released a statement through social media, confirming that it is "actively pursuing legal action against individuals posting defamatory content about G-Dragon."
The agency revealed that after collecting fan reports and related evidence up until late September, it officially filed complaints on October 15 against several users for violating the Information and Communications Network Act (defamation).
The company emphasized its strict stance, noting that it is particularly focused on cases involving false information and serious defamation, ensuring perpetrators face legal consequences.
Further complaints are expected. Galaxy Corporation stated, "We will continue to cooperate with investigative authorities to take action across major domestic platforms and online communities."
The company concluded, "We are committed to ensuring our artist can create in a healthy environment and thank fans for their continuous support and information reports."
